Summary
Reserve Millwork in Bedford Heights, OH has an immediate opening for a Senior Project Manager. The role leads complex, high‑value projects from concept through closeout in a fast‑paced manufacturing environment. Success in the role requires a highly strategic thinker with deep millwork industry experience—preferably including hands‑on shop‑floor exposure—and the ability to drive alignment across cross‑functional teams without direct supervisory responsibility. The ideal candidate anticipates challenges before they arise, communicates proactively, and delivers exceptional results with a strong sense of ownership, accountability, and craftsmanship.
Responsibilities
- Lead complex projects from Letter of Intent (LOI) through closeout and warranty follow‑up.
- Develop strategic project plans, schedules, budgets, and documentation using ERP software (INNERGY).
- Establish clear expectations with clients, General Contractors, architects, and internal teams.
- Apply strategic thinking to anticipate risks, identify bottlenecks, and implement proactive mitigation strategies.
- Review and interpret architectural and shop drawings to ensure scope accuracy and manufacturability.
- Coordinate engineering submittals and manage RFIs, ASIs, and project documentation with disciplined accuracy.
- Coordinate and oversee vendors supplying non‑shop‑produced products, ensuring quality, specification compliance, and seamless schedule integration.
- Lead internal project reviews to align Engineering, Production, and Installation teams around priorities and milestones.
- Resolve issues with long‑term project impacts in mind, balancing schedule, cost, and quality.
- Maintain precise financial tracking, schedule updates, and forecasting in ERP throughout the project lifecycle.
- Manage change orders with strategic evaluation and thorough documentation.
- Provide field support and problem‑solving during installation and site coordination.
- Oversee punch lists, as‑builts, closeout documentation, and warranty follow‑up.
- Conduct post‑project analysis and recommend strategic process improvements.
- Model the company’s values of integrity, craftsmanship, and client trust.

About Reserve Millwork
Since 1980, Reserve Millwork’s reputation and focus are on high-end commercial projects that include reception desks, boardroom tables, cabinetry, etc. The primary customers are large general contractors; however, Reserve maintains relationships with developers, owners, and architects as well. Reserve delivers, projects across the U.S. End-users of RMI’s work includes healthcare, corporate, legal, institutional, and governmental/civic customers. Reserve takes great pride in utilizing an intentional combination of industry expertise, old world craftsmanship, and state-of-the-art manufacturing equipment to construct almost any design imaginable. The team of project managers, engineers, cabinetmakers, woodworkers, and finishers have combined industry experience of over 200 years, giving our clients the advantage of an unmatched level of industry expertise.
